Understanding Slot Variance

The variance of slot games determines how often players win and the size of their payouts. It is important for gamers to be aware of this to maximize their hacksaw gaming slot machine games experience.

An effective method to determine the game's variance is to examine its pay table. If the difference between three and five symbol wins is minimal chances are you're playing a low or medium variance game.

High variance slots are great for those who love the excitement of chasing big jackpots. They typically have a lower odds of winning smaller amounts and are more risky than low or medium variance slots. However, the huge payouts these games offer are worth the risk for some players.

Low volatility slots are perfect for those with the funds to play, or are just beginning to learn about online gambling. These games pay out winnings more frequently, however the amounts per player are less than in high variance slots. NetEnt's Starburst and Play'n Go's Moon Princess are two examples of low variance slots.

Slots with a medium variance are ideal for both beginners and veterans who want to enjoy the thrill of big winnings while still making regular profits. These slots are fun to play, but require patience and discipline. Avoid chasing losses as they can quickly drain your bankroll.

Depending on the type of game you choose, you may be looking for Scatter symbols that trigger bonus features. These could range from free spins, additional game rounds or a new bonus game with different rules and reels. Some of these symbols are multifunctional and can be used as Wilds or to create additional scatters. The symbol list is available in the information menu or on the official website of the slot machine.

The majority of slots pay on lines or ways, meaning that you need to hit them in certain positions on the connecting reels to win the prize. However, there are some games that break the pattern and pay based on the amount of Scatter symbols present anywhere in the game. These are referred to as Scatter Symbols and they make playing these games much more exciting.
